亚洲激情专区-91九色丨porny丨老师-久久久久久久女国产乱让韩-国产精品午夜小视频观看

溫馨提示×

如何測試SQL DISTINCT語句的性能

sql
小樊
82
2024-10-16 05:49:59
欄目: 云計算

要測試SQL DISTINCT語句的性能,您可以采取以下步驟:

  1. 準備測試數據:首先,您需要準備一個包含重復數據的測試表。確保數據量足夠大,以便能夠觀察到性能差異。
  2. 編寫SQL查詢:編寫一個使用DISTINCT關鍵字的SQL查詢,以從測試表中檢索不重復的數據。
  3. 使用計時工具:在執行查詢之前,啟動一個計時工具(如MySQL的慢查詢日志或SQL Server的SQL Server Profiler),以便記錄查詢的執行時間。
  4. 執行查詢:執行SQL查詢,并觀察計時工具記錄的時間。注意查詢的響應時間和資源使用情況(如CPU、內存和磁盤I/O)。
  5. 優化查詢:根據觀察到的性能問題,考慮對查詢進行優化。這可能包括添加索引、重寫查詢或使用其他技術來減少查詢成本。
  6. 重復測試:在應用任何優化后,重新執行查詢并記錄性能數據。比較優化前后的性能差異,以評估優化效果。
  7. 分析結果:仔細分析計時工具提供的數據,以確定查詢性能瓶頸所在。考慮是否需要進一步調整查詢或數據庫結構以改善性能。

請注意,測試SQL DISTINCT語句的性能時,還需要考慮其他因素,如數據庫管理系統(DBMS)的版本和配置、硬件資源以及查詢的復雜性等。這些因素都可能對查詢性能產生影響。因此,在進行性能測試時,請確保控制這些變量,以便準確地評估DISTINCT語句的性能。

0
临澧县| 三江| 西乌珠穆沁旗| 洞口县| 厦门市| 黔东| 白水县| 砚山县| 绩溪县| 黎城县| 沾益县| 新余市| 元江| 天台县| 华蓥市| 涞源县| 沂水县| 镇原县| 原平市| 松溪县| 岳池县| 丰顺县| 郁南县| 罗江县| 长顺县| 咸宁市| 曲靖市| 卫辉市| 遂溪县| 林州市| 台湾省| 惠来县| 闽清县| 隆林| 鹤峰县| 岳阳市| 黄平县| 利津县| 沽源县| 安丘市| 勃利县|